Construction has begun on Phase 1 of Airia Development Company’s Colton, a 5,700-acre master-planned community near Todd Mission and Magnolia, according to an April 3 news release.

The community, which has a build-out value estimated at $9.9 billion, will include single-family homes alongside around 500 acres of mixed-used parcels planned for uses such as multifamily, retail and medical, according to the news release.

Students living in the first phase of the community will attend Magnolia ISD, according to the news release. Colton will be designed to include proposed future on-site schools.

Construction on model homes is anticipated to begin this fall with homebuilders set to begin sales in 2025, according to the news release.
